Rome2Rio

How to get fromBeirut to Machynllethby plane, train, car, car train or car ferry

Find Transport to Machynlleth

See all options

There are 6 ways to get from Beirut to Machynlleth by plane, train, car, car train, or car ferry

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Fly to Birmingham Airport, train

    best
    1. Fly from Beirut International Airport (BEY) to Birmingham Airport (BHX)planeBEY - BHX
    2. Take the train from Birmingham International to Machynllethtrain
    11h
    £229–687
  2. Fly to Manchester Airport, train

    cheapest
    1. Fly from Beirut International Airport (BEY) to Manchester Airport (MAN)planeBEY - MAN
    2. Take the train from Wilmslow to Shrewsburytrain
    3. Take the train from Shrewsbury to Machynllethtrain
    12h 14m
    £145–257
  3. Drive, Eurotunnel

    1. Drive from Beirut to Calais-Fréthuncar
    2. Take the car train from Calais-Fréthun to Folkestonecartrain
    3. Drive from Folkestone to Machynllethcar
    45h 5m
  4. Fly to London Heathrow Airport, train

    1. Fly from Beirut International Airport (BEY) to London Heathrow Airport (LHR)planeBEY - LHR
    2. Take the train from London Euston to Birmingham New Streettrain
    3. Take the train from Birmingham New Street to Machynllethtrain
    10h 57m
    £265–710
  5. Fly to Cardiff Airport, train

    1. Fly from Beirut International Airport (BEY) to Cardiff Airport (CWL)planeBEY - CWL
    2. Take the train from Cardiff Central to Shrewsburytrain
    3. Take the train from Shrewsbury to Machynllethtrain
    17h 50m
    £207–588
  6. Drive, car ferry

    1. Drive from Beirut to Calaiscar
    2. Take the car ferry from Calais to Port of Dovercarferry
    3. Drive from Port of Dover to Machynllethcar
    46h 7m
    £679–987

Beirut International Airport (BEY) to Birmingham Airport (BHX) flights

Calendar45Weekly Planes
Duration9h 30mAverage Duration
Ticket£135Cheapest Price
See schedules

Questions & Answers

What companies run services between Beirut, Lebanon and Machynlleth, Wales?

There is no direct connection from Beirut to Machynlleth. However, you can take the taxi to Beirut International Airport (BEY) airport, fly to Birmingham Airport (BHX), walk to Birmingham International Airport, take the vehicle to Birmingham Intl Rail Station, walk to Birmingham International, then take the train to Machynlleth. Alternatively, you can take a vehicle from Beirut to Machynlleth via Calais-Fréthun and Folkestone in around 45h 5m.

Airlines
Train operators
Ferry operators

Want to know more about travelling around United Kingdom

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.

Related travel guides